Broadbent & Macdonald Join Mortimer's London-Set Romance

Emily Mortimer's upcoming directorial debut, titled 'Dennis,' has added notable British talent to its ensemble. Jim Broadbent, Kelly Macdonald, and Jamie Demetriou are now set to star in the romance film.
'Dennis' will feature Alison Oliver as a British student and Yura Borisov, recently seen in 'Anora,' as a Russian poet. Their characters fall in love in Moscow during the 1990s. The project is written and directed by BAFTA-nominated Emily Mortimer, who previously worked on 'The Pursuit of Love' and 'Doll and Em.'
Production is underway with Emma Stone, Dave McCary, and Ali Herting producing for Fruit Tree, alongside Mortimer and her King Bee Productions partners. A24 is handling worldwide distribution and financing for the film, continuing its collaboration with Fruit Tree on various projects.
